Transaction 3d2f690288976397401783bcbbcb2eecceeef006cad1f29f18550520caf7fefa

1 Input
2 Outputs
  • 3d2f690288976397401783bcbbcb2eecceeef006cad1f29f18550520caf7fefa:0
  • value  2590771
    address  334VT3TbWuRbHm5DzEeuuWujw5LL7jy4kK
  • 3d2f690288976397401783bcbbcb2eecceeef006cad1f29f18550520caf7fefa:1
  • value  37040
    address  16KvJN2iQb6L8Mm4LpSbkUFPiUeQh9QAa9